Ron Ten-Hove wrote:


	Self-scheduling processes are in general a bad thing. Scheduling is a separate concern from the process logic itself. The fact that one must alter the process definition in order to alter the scheduling policy is indicative of inappropriate coupling between the two. I suggest that we not burden BPEL with features that encourage poor practices.
